发明名称 REGENERATION OF DENITRATION CATALYST AND REGENERATED CATALYST
摘要 PROBLEM TO BE SOLVED: To regenerate a catalyst in a degree of regeneration equal to or more than that achieved by washing of conventional technique in low cost without discharging waste water. SOLUTION: A coating layer containing a catalyst component containing either one of titanium oxide and vanadium oxide, titanium oxide, vanadium oxide and molybdenum oxide, titanium oxide, vanadium oxide and tungsten oxide and titanium oxide, vanadium oxide, molybdenum oxide and tungsten oxide and a sulfate radical is provided on the surface of an exhaust gas denitration catalyst lowered in its activity by the adhesion of an alkali metal or alkaline earth metal element. The coating layer is formed on the surface of a deteriorated catalyst by applying a slurry prepared from a powder of a catalyst component, sulfuric acid and/or sulfate and water by a spray method or an immersion method. In the relation of the amt. of the sulfate radical supported on the deteriorated catalyst and the amt. of a deteriorated component, the sulfate radical is supported so that the total chemical equivalent of the supported sulfate radical and that of an alkali metal or alkaline earth metal is larger than 1.
